From the Desk of the GM - May 4, 2009

“Another fantastic Open House”

Saturday’s open house was another great day. This was our 16th annual open house and it may have been the best yet, at least from the weather standpoint. Over the years, we have had some very cold, rainy, snowy days for our open house. So, to wake up yesterday to clear skies and about 13 degrees (okay, it wasn’t 13 first thing in the morning, but it got there), it was a load off my mind. It was also a load off the minds of the other 20 or so Goldeyes staff members who make an event like yesterday happen.

Some staff have been through this day many times before, whereas there are some it was their first time. It’s a bit of an eye-opener for those who have never experienced the open house. The day is full of “controlled chaos” with things that we hadn’t planned for popping up every once in a while. You would think after 15 years, we would have seen it all but every year, something comes up that we weren’t expecting.

The fan turnout was spectacular, the weather was as good as we could have hoped for, individual ticket sales went well and the 2009 Goldeyes squad looked great practicing on the field.
